For intense workouts, I always recommend true wireless earbuds with at least IPX7 waterproof rating - they can handle sweat sessions and even sudden rain during outdoor runs. The battery life needs to be substantial too; my current favorites last about 8.5 hours on a single charge, which means I can get through multiple workouts without worrying about constant recharging. What many people don't realize is that the fit matters just as much as the sound quality. I've lost count of how many times I've seen people at the gym constantly adjusting their earphones mid-set - that's just unacceptable when you're trying to maintain intensity.

The right earphones should deliver clear highs and substantial bass without distortion, even at higher volumes. I've found that models with 10mm drivers typically perform best for sports use, providing that perfect balance of clarity and power that keeps you motivated.

One aspect that often gets overlooked is the charging case design. I prefer compact cases that can easily fit in my gym shorts pocket without creating bulk. My current top pick comes with a case that provides three additional full charges and features a sleek, sweat-resistant design. The touch controls need to be intuitive too - there's nothing more frustrating than struggling to skip tracks when you're in the middle of an intense interval. After testing numerous models, I've found that physical buttons often work better than touch controls for sweaty workouts, though the latest touch technology has improved significantly.

What really separates good sports earphones from great ones is how they handle real-world conditions. I remember testing a pair during a particularly grueling hill sprint session - the combination of heavy breathing, sweat, and rapid head movements is the ultimate test for any sports earphone. The best models I've used feature some form of ear fin or wingtip system that creates a secure seal without causing discomfort. Sound isolation is another critical factor; you want enough ambient noise reduction to stay focused, but still be aware of your surroundings, especially for outdoor activities. Some of the newer models actually include transparency modes that let you control how much outside noise you hear - it's brilliant technology that's genuinely useful.
